This is an enormously good and moving film -- it's easy to see why it won an Oscar. It's about family, growing up, grief, friendship, revenge, love, responsibility, and forgiveness, and if I've left anything out please forgive me.
It's almost a Danish Huckleberry Finn, minus Mark Twain's earthy humor (which is more than made up for by the director's feeling for, and insight into, her characters). I watched it with two family members, and while we rarely agree on movies, this one had us all enthralled.
Why don't we have more movies like this? It would be a better world if we did.
